Improving disease resistance to stem rust and powdery mildew in wheat using D genome introgressions from Aegilops Tauschii / by Andrew Thomas Wiersma.

Stem rust (Puccinia graminis) and powdery mildew ( Blumeria graminis) are persistent threats to hexaploid wheat ( Triticum aestivum L., 2n=6x=42, AABBDD) production worldwide.
